
George Feickert of North Dakota became a Prisoner of War during World War II.
Serving in the U.S. Army, Corps of Engineers, CE: CORPS OF ENGINEERS, George was captured by GERMANY and was imprisoned at Stalag 2B Hammerstein (99 work camps in vicinity of Koslin - Stolp) West Prussia 53-17. Final information at the end of the conflict was Returned to Military Control, Liberated or Repatriated. Data shows George was in 7116 Unit/Area/100th Infantry Division Undefined Code North African Theatre: Italy. Source. US National Archives.
